ATTO Disk Benchmark Result Samsung 980 Pro PCIe 4.0 NVMe SSD 500GB MZ-V8P500BW on older ASUS Mainboard (i5)

because Win 10 compared to Win 7 is incredibly slow, a way to upgrade an older ASUS Mainboard was found

  • RAM was increased from 8 GB to 32 GB
  • it actually had an M.2 slot for the MZ-V8P500BW NVMe SSD (it is a NVMe but not directly PCIe attached but speaks to mainboard via SATA (SSD))

while not close to the theoreticall possible speeds of:

Read: 6,900 MB/s

Write: 5,000 MB/s

(src: do they mean Bits or Bytes here?)

imho those are impressive harddisk speeds, well done Samsung 🙂
